Funds Raised After CA Dad Detained While Driving Wife To Hospital

Joel Arrona-Lara was detained by ICE officers while driving his wife to the hospital to give birth to their fifth child.

INLAND EMPIRE, CA -- A fundraiser was underway Monday for a California family whose patriarch was cuffed last week while driving his wife to the hospital to give birth to their fifth child. U.S. Customs and Immigration Enforcement said its officers detained Joel Arrona-Lara because there is a warrant out for his arrest for a homicide in Mexico.

Arrona-Lara was detained when he and his wife, Maria del Carmen Venegas, stopped in San Bernardino to get gas while driving to the hospital. After Arrona-Lara was detained, Venegas drove herself to the hospital to give birth to a baby boy, she told the media.

Now, loved ones are asking the public for help in supporting the couple's family as Arrona-Lara is the breadwinner.

"We are asking with all our heart if you can help with this family that is destroyed by an injustice by ICE," loved ones wrote on GoFundMe in Spanish. "(They have) taken this man from this family with no motive, being a hard-working man always taking care of his family."

Loved ones reject ICE's claim that there is a warrant for his detainment, claiming he was simply detained because he did not have identification with him.

"There was no order towards him," the GoFundMe page said.

"Now we ask for your help for the Arrona family and their kids who are destroyed and crying for the daddy," the GoFundMe said. "Help them. They need your help. Help them today, for it might be you tomorrow."
